My book on runes is a little guide that I published at lulu.com. It is very easy to use. It was the perfect venue/tool for that project. Have I been paid? I have sold about 6 sets of runes with the books as a set. I had a friend edit the work. Interesting though even though the book was edited by my friend and I it came with some typos in the printing. I think there may have been a glitch in the upload that caused it. I would use it again for special projects but not really big stuff. If I were to do a big book I think I would seek a different publishing resource.
